November they wills start airing the 4 episodes of the NHL Celebrity Shootout Poker Tournament (which Luongo final tabled):
Airtimes on ESPN Classic:
11/24 at 10pm (ep. #1)
12/1 at 10pm (ep. #2)
12/8 at 10pm (ep. #3)
12/15 at 10pm (ep. #4)
The final table consisted of Vanessa Rousso, Mats Sundin, Scott Hartnell, Roberto Luongo, Glenn Anderson, Kris Versteeg, Jeremy Roenick, Eddie Olczyk, and Murray Ungurain (a PokerStars qualifier). -
